project: Rev 182

This commit is contained in:
Owain van Brakel
2019-08-29 16:04:20 +02:00
parent 0c1dd644d8
commit 6485eb9bed
349 changed files with 51857 additions and 50740 deletions

View File

@@ -3,22 +3,22 @@ import net.runelite.mapping.Implements;
import net.runelite.mapping.ObfuscatedName;
import net.runelite.mapping.ObfuscatedSignature;
@ObfuscatedName("id")
@ObfuscatedName("ip")
@Implements("VarcInt")
public class VarcInt extends DualNode {
@ObfuscatedName("q")
@ObfuscatedName("s")
@ObfuscatedSignature(
signature = "Lhp;"
signature = "Lhz;"
)
@Export("VarcInt_archive")
public static AbstractArchive VarcInt_archive;
@ObfuscatedName("w")
@ObfuscatedName("j")
@ObfuscatedSignature(
signature = "Lel;"
signature = "Lep;"
)
@Export("VarcInt_cached")
public static EvictingDualNodeHashTable VarcInt_cached;
@ObfuscatedName("e")
static EvictingDualNodeHashTable VarcInt_cached;
@ObfuscatedName("i")
@Export("persist")
public boolean persist;
@@ -26,73 +26,58 @@ public class VarcInt extends DualNode {
VarcInt_cached = new EvictingDualNodeHashTable(64);
}
public VarcInt() {
VarcInt() {
this.persist = false;
}
@ObfuscatedName("w")
@ObfuscatedName("j")
@ObfuscatedSignature(
signature = "(Lkf;B)V",
garbageValue = "22"
signature = "(Lky;I)V",
garbageValue = "-1564347413"
)
public void method4401(Buffer var1) {
void method4314(Buffer var1) {
while (true) {
int var2 = var1.readUnsignedByte();
if (var2 == 0) {
return;
}
this.method4396(var1, var2);
this.method4315(var1, var2);
}
}
@ObfuscatedName("e")
@ObfuscatedName("i")
@ObfuscatedSignature(
signature = "(Lkf;II)V",
garbageValue = "958337922"
signature = "(Lky;II)V",
garbageValue = "-1760139411"
)
void method4396(Buffer var1, int var2) {
void method4315(Buffer var1, int var2) {
if (var2 == 2) {
this.persist = true;
}
}
@ObfuscatedName("e")
@ObfuscatedName("s")
@ObfuscatedSignature(
signature = "(Ljava/lang/CharSequence;S)Ljava/lang/String;",
garbageValue = "-32757"
signature = "(II)Lis;",
garbageValue = "-1763982471"
)
@Export("base37Decode")
public static String base37Decode(CharSequence var0) {
long var3 = 0L;
int var5 = var0.length();
for (int var6 = 0; var6 < var5; ++var6) {
var3 *= 37L;
char var7 = var0.charAt(var6);
if (var7 >= 'A' && var7 <= 'Z') {
var3 += (long)(var7 + 1 - 65);
} else if (var7 >= 'a' && var7 <= 'z') {
var3 += (long)(var7 + 1 - 97);
} else if (var7 >= '0' && var7 <= '9') {
var3 += (long)(var7 + 27 - 48);
@Export("getParamDefinition")
public static ParamDefinition getParamDefinition(int var0) {
ParamDefinition var1 = (ParamDefinition)ParamDefinition.ParamDefinition_cached.get((long)var0);
if (var1 != null) {
return var1;
} else {
byte[] var2 = class339.ParamDefinition_archive.takeFile(11, var0);
var1 = new ParamDefinition();
if (var2 != null) {
var1.decode(new Buffer(var2));
}
if (var3 >= 177917621779460413L) {
break;
}
var1.postDecode();
ParamDefinition.ParamDefinition_cached.put(var1, (long)var0);
return var1;
}
while (var3 % 37L == 0L && 0L != var3) {
var3 /= 37L;
}
String var8 = class215.base37DecodeLong(var3);
if (var8 == null) {
var8 = "";
}
return var8;
}
}